phosphoglucomutase  M-CSA #352

Phosphoglucomutase catalyses the transfer of a phosphate fragment between the 1- and 6-O atoms of glucose. As suggested by the enzyme's name, in its stable form it exists esterified, at the gamma-hydroxyl group of Ser116. The enzyme is involved in the glycogenolysis pathway. Once a 1-phosphate glucose molecule is released from glycogen by glycogen phosphorylase, phosphoglucomutase catalyses the interconversion of this relatively useless metabolic intermediate into 6-phosphate glucose. This metabolite can then be utilised in multiple cellular pathways including the glycolytic, pentose phosphate or biosynthetic pathways. When glucose levels are high, phosphoglucomutase can act in the opposite fashion, converting 6-phosphate glucose to 1-phosphate glucose. In combination with UDP-glucose-pyrophosphorylase and glycogen synthase, this change in equilibrium will result in the reformation of the 1-phosphate glucose monomer with a glycogen polymer.
